Car Key Cutter Machines

smart-logo.pngCar key cutting is more than creating a metal piece. It's a skill that provides security, efficiency, and ease of use for car owners.

Standard keys are cut with a key duplicator machine, where the original is positioned on one side and lined up using a special cutting tool to serve as a template. Key guides keep the two keys in place while the duplication.

Machines

The machines used to cut keys help shape the blanks. The process is more than simply forming a piece metal, however; it also involves drawing the contours of the key blank and cutting it to precisely match the original key. Anyone who offers locksmith services should have a key cutter for their car.

A car key cutter makes use of a specific clamp to hold the original key, and a specially-designed cutting blade to make a duplicate key. The original key is used as a model and the cutter uses software to determine the exact cuts required to make the proper shape. This ensures that the new key will function properly and fit perfectly into the lock. There are many different types of key cutters for cars. These include automatic, manual semi-automatic, and manual. They are typically made of robust materials and have a lever to start the cutting process.

Edge type keys are frequently used for car keys. They are commonly used to unlock mailboxes, doors and locks, but a lot of automobiles also use them. These keys aren't as secure and simple to cut as transponder keys, but still provide good security.

Consider buying a machine that can do both laser and edge cuts If you're looking for a key cutting machine. These machines can be more expensive than other models, but they offer greater flexibility and better performance. For instance, some them feature an adjustable chip tray that can be used to clean up debris after each job. Others have a USB port that enables users to import code tables and update the software of the device without having to remove the tablet.

A high-quality machine will not only be able to cut a variety of kinds of keys, but should also have an integrated database which allows you to search for a specific vehicle model or keyway. This feature allows you to save time and effort because you don't have to look for codes manually. It also helps to increase your efficiency by avoiding mistakes that could result in an incorrectly aligned key.

Key Blanks

Key blanks are shaped from metal with grooves, notches and other features that align with the various pins and wards that are found inside the lock. The end result is the same whether they're cut using disk-type key cutters or pins and warding machines, or even by hand using files. To prevent key duplicates, mobile key cutting service blanks can have various imprints pre-stamped on them. Key rings are a good example and a 'Do not duplicate mark.

When creating a new car key, locksmiths first determine the key blank type that will fit the particular lock. This can be accomplished by comparing the key blank to the key that is already in use or by decoding cuts of the current car key and matching it to the proper biting in the key cutting machine. The key blank is then cut according to the exact specifications of the original key.

The key blank part number is a number that identifies the manufacturer of the lock and permits locksmiths to find other key blanks that are suitable for duplication. The identification codes may contain information regarding the transponder chip of the key which is used to operate certain modern vehicles. A key blank that has a GM code (B111PT) will have a transponder encrypted, whereas a key blank with a Texas Instruments Fixed Code programmable Transponder is clonable.

Some key blanks may not work with all locks. This is why locksmiths have multiple types of keys in stock. A locksmith that specializes in car key will need both an automotive transponder blank and a basic blank key for each make and model of car.

It is easy to replace keys for various automobiles by bringing your current key into an AutoZone. The associate will select the right key blank for the year, year of manufacture and model of the vehicle, and then trace it on a precise key cutting machine on site. This procedure is fast and can be used to replace both the ignition and door keys. The only exception is when the key has transponder chips that need to be programmed.

Keyway Milling

Keyways are a standard feature in a wide range of components. Gears, pulleys, couplings and pump sleeves all need keyways to connect the parts and form a secure bond. Milling machines offer the most accurate results. Other types of machining equipment can also be used to make keyways, like EDM machines, shaping machines and key seating machine.

Keyways are milled typically performed using a special milling tool with the correct cutter's diameter and width for the keyway. This milling cutter has to be able to withstand the extreme precision required to process the keyway. The keyway milling process can be a little more complicated than traditional milling, however it is a highly reliable method for cutting.

The CLIMAX 3000 is a portable key mill that is able to cut both round and square-ended keyways from shafts of different dimensions. This machine can cut keys to full depth in less than 4 minutes. The clamping system allows you to place your workpiece in the milling vise quickly. This machine is ideal for keyway cutting on large-scale industrial machines as well as shipbuilding and power generation applications.

Shaping is a different method of keyway cutting but it can be limited in precision and accuracy. To achieve consistently reliable results, this process requires the expertise of the user. The surfaces that are shaped may be more rough than the ones created by other methods.

Lastly, keyeating can be a reliable method to cut keys. However, it could be more expensive than other methods. Keyeating is a continuous cutting process, so it can be more efficient than shaping or wire EDM. Additionally, it is a great choice for machining hard or difficult-to-machine parts.
